Is Costa Rica warmer or hotter than East Norwalk, Connecticut?

On average across the year, yes, Costa Rica is hotter than East Norwalk, Connecticut . Costa Rica has an average temperature of 25°C/77°F and East Norwalk, Connecticut has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F.

Costa Rica's hottest month is April,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F, which is hotter than East Norwalk, Connecticut's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F).

Is Costa Rica colder or cooler than East Norwalk, Connecticut?

On average across the year, no, Costa Rica is not colder than East Norwalk, Connecticut . Costa Rica has an average minimum temperature of 20°C/68°F and East Norwalk, Connecticut has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F.



Costa Rica's coldest month is October, with an average minimum temperature of 19°C/66°F, which is not colder than East Norwalk, Connecticut's coldest month (January, with an average minimum temperature of -4°C/25°F).

Does Costa Rica have more rain than East Norwalk, Connecticut?

On average across the year, yes, Costa Rica has more rain than East Norwalk, Connecticut. Costa Rica has an average annual rainfall of 1358mm and East Norwalk, Connecticut has an average annual rainfall of 1269mm.

Costa Rica's wettest month is October, with an average monthly rainfall of 212mm, which is wetter than East Norwalk, Connecticut's wettest month (December, with an average monthly rainfall of 126mm).
